From your description and previous query I understand that you have been giving adequate liquids.
Despite that urine output is less.
The fever could no longer be attributed to heat dehydration.
With cold and cough I think there is a respiratory infection mostly viral.
You need to get your child examined by your pediatrician thoroughly to rule out ear nose throat or chest infection and assess his dehydration.
Giving over the counter drugs may be harmful at this age.
Do consult your pediatrician soon.
Continue current liquids and feeding as you are giving now.
Viral infection may take upto a week to settle.
